The ideal candidate will possess strong leadership skills, excellent communication abilities, and a passion for fitness. Previous experience in a fitness or customer service environment is preferred. A background in management or supervisory roles will be an advantage. You should also have a proactive approach to problem-solving and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ment.
About the job
The Assistant Studio Manager at Equinox Newton plays a key part in daily studio operations. This role supports the Studio Manager to ensure a smooth experience for both members and staff. Maintaining a high level of service is central to the position, with a focus on upholding Equinox standards throughout the studio.
Main responsibilities
Assist the Studio Manager with staff scheduling and coordination
Help plan and carry out studio events
Lead, support, and motivate the fitness team
Ensure service standards are met in every aspect of studio operations

Our headquarters is located in Newton, MA.The Role of Supply Planning ManagerWe are seeking a collaborative and detail-oriented individual to join our in-house Supply Chain operations. This role will encompass all aspects of production scheduling and planning, ensuring MRP accuracy and execution, making strategic production allocation decisions, communicating with our supplier and co-packer partners, and managing ERP inventory transactions. This position is pivotal in achieving the company's annual goals related to sales, margin, and customer service.Key Responsibilities:Lead supply chain planning, including MRP, purchasing execution, production planning, and product allocation.Collaborate with Sales, Sourcing, and Supply Chain Planning teams to order materials and ingredients in both short-term and long-range strategies to align purchasing with forecasted demand.Identify best practices and oversee the transactional execution and management of a NetSuite inventory system.Enhance inventory control and accuracy for both raw materials and finished goods across our network of co-packers and 3PLs.Maintain strong communication across functions, especially Manufacturing, Quality, and Sales.Engage actively with supplier and co-packer partners to ensure timelines are met efficiently.Take ownership of annual and monthly cost planning and analysis, ensuring accountability to meet COGS goals.Achieve corporate and specific functional objectives.Identify and implement opportunities for procedural and policy improvements that deliver value to the business.Elevate organizational and process capabilities throughout the entire supply chain.Develop one, three, and five-year operational plans to provide a roadmap for future planning and necessary investments for scaling the business.
Key Responsibilities:As a Registered Veterinary Technician, you will be instrumental in providing exceptional care to our animal patients. Your duties will encompass animal restraint, triage for incoming patients, collection and analysis of lab samples, diagnostic imaging, and the management of both medical and hospitalized cases. You will also be responsible for administering medications, effectively communicating treatment plans with clients, assisting in surgical preparation, and managing anesthesia during procedures.It is essential to be comfortable with potentially unpleasant odors and noises, as well as the risk of bites, scratches, and exposure to animal waste or communicable diseases.At Newton Animal Clinic, we value your professional growth and provide numerous opportunities for both virtual and hands-on training, enabling you to enhance your skills and advance your career.

We value the unique talents and perspectives each employee brings, fostering a vibrant, fast-paced culture that encourages creativity and collaboration.The Quality Engineer will play a crucial role in enhancing quality standards, educating teams on quality techniques, addressing issues, and promoting quality across production and service departments. While this role is based in Newton, NJ, occasional travel to other Thorlabs locations may be required.Key Responsibilities:Maintain the Quality System and ensure compliance with standards.Analyze and prepare Quality trend data and QA reports.Conduct root cause and failure analysis, implementing corrective actions for process issues and customer feedback.Collaborate with production and engineering managers to establish and uphold inspection and acceptance criteria for components, subassemblies, and final products.Drive continuous improvement initiatives within the quality system, utilizing methodologies such as 5S, Kaizen, and lean practices.Train production staff to enhance quality awareness and practices.Work with RMA and Service departments to inspect and resolve issues with customer returns.Conduct audits, prepare reports, and implement corrective and preventive actions based on findings.Create and manage quality documentation, including manuals, procedures, and inspection templates.Review RFQs and Purchase Orders for quality-related clauses and requirements.The Quality Engineer is also expected to uphold company standards related to work quality and quantity, adhering to all policies and procedures.
